The term 'Swiss quartz' may not be one that'll ring any bells as time goes by

Further to the Swiss trade balance data released earlier, the details show that Swiss watchmakers have shipped the fewest number of quartz watches in 33 years.

In terms of value, the 17 million quartz watches shipped was worth CHF 3.5 billion - lower by 3.8% compared to that of 2016.

Mechanical timepieces have been gaining popularity over the years, and the introduction of fitness watches and smart watches (Apple has been the biggest beneficiary in this area) certainly hasn't helped in that regard. While the Swiss economy will surely continue to do fine (exports of all watches still grew on the year), one of the hallmarks associated with the country may soon fade away - at least to the general society.
